Definitions:

Aggregate Consumption

This refers to the total amount of goods and services consumed by a population or economy over a certain period.

Consumption Function

An economic formula that represents the relationship between total consumption and gross national income.

Aggregate Income

The total income earned by all individuals or entities in an economy, including wages, profits, rents, and investment earnings, over a specific time period.
